Groton City, Connecticut Census 2020 Voting-age Population By Race and Ethnicity

Updated on February 22, 2026.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, the 7.47K voting-age population of Groton City, CT residents comprised of 1.14K residents who identified as Hispanic or Latino (15.21%), and 6.33K residents who identified as Non-Hispanic (84.79%).

Race: The White Alone voting-age population was the largest racial group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 4.96K (66.43%). The Two Or More Races voting-age population was the second largest racial group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 709 (9.49%). The Black or African American Alone voting-age population was the third largest racial group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 645 (8.64%). The smallest racial group in Groton City, CT was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one with a voting-age population of 19 (0.25%).

Ethnicity: The Non-Hispanic - White Alone voting-age population was the largest ethnic group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 4.76K (63.79%). The Non-Hispanic - Black Alone voting-age population was the second largest ethnic group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 573 (7.67%). The Hispanic - Some Other Race Alone voting-age population was the third largest ethnic group in Groton City, CT, with a voting-age population of 524 (7.02%). The smallest ethnic group in Groton City, CT was Hispanic - Native Hawaiian & Pac. Islander with a voting-age population of 2 (0.03%).

Groton City, CT Voting-age Population of Racial Groups in Census 2020
0 of 0
Race Voting-age Population % of City or Place Voting-age Population
Black or African American Alone 645 8.64
White Alone 4961 66.43
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 60 0.80
Asian Alone 491 6.58
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 19 0.25
Some Other Race Alone 583 7.81
Two Or More Races 709 9.49
Groton City, CT Voting-age Population of Ethnicity Groups in Census 2020
0 of 0
Ethnicity Voting-age Population % of City or Place Voting-age Population
Non-Hispanic - White Alone 4764 63.79
Non-Hispanic - Black Alone 573 7.67
Hispanic - Some Other Race Alone 524 7.02
Non-Hispanic - Asian Alone 479 6.41
Non-Hispanic - Two or More Races 391 5.24
Hispanic - Two or More Races 318 4.26
Hispanic - White Alone 197 2.64
Hispanic - Black Alone 72 0.96
Non-Hispanic - Some Other Race Alone 59 0.79
Non-Hispanic - American Indian & Alaska Native 49 0.66
Non-Hispanic - Native Hawaiian & Pac. Islander 17 0.23
Hispanic - Asian Alone 12 0.16
Hispanic - American Indian & Alaska Native 11 0.15
Hispanic - Native Hawaiian & Pac. Islander 2 0.03
